Columbus Short hosting a Scandal premiere party despite being fired from the show

Well, this is awkward. Columbus Short is hosting a Scandal season 4 premiere party despite being fired from the hit ABC show this past April. The actor, who played Olivia Pope’s right-hand man Harrison Wright on the drama, posted a flyer to his Instagram promoting the party, which is set to go down at Boogalou Lounge in Atlanta, Ga. on Thursday, Sept. 25.

“GLADIATORS #standup #ItsGoingDown #Gladiator available tomorrow on #ITUNES and the long awaited premiere of #Scandal @kriskelli @bigblockesc #CoStarz,” Short captioned the post.

On Valentine’s Day, Short was charged with misdemeanor spousal battery and ordered to stay away from wife Tuere Short, who later filed for divorce. In late March, Short was arrested again on a felony battery charge after a restaurant brawl.

Following the incidents, Short confirmed to Us Weekly he was exiting the show after three seasons. 

“At this time I must confirm my exit from a show I’ve called home for 3 years, with what is the most talented ensemble on television today,” Short said. “I would like to first thank [creator] Shonda Rhimes for the opportunity to work with such an amazing cast. Thank you GLADIATORS, who have supported me throughout my entire career and of course to ABC and Shondaland for allowing me to play such a pivotal role in the Scandal series. I have enjoyed every single minute of it. Everything must come to an end and unfortunately the time has come for Harrison Wright to exit the canvas. I wish nothing but the best for Shonda, Kerry and the rest of the cast, who have become like a second family to me in such a short amount of time. For this, I will forever be grateful.”

In an interview with Access Hollywood in July, the actor admitted that his TV family “knew that I was going through a tough season and … they did the right thing.” 

Fans were left with Short’s character being held at gunpoint in the season 3 finale.
